pm-pmu (8) Linux Manual Page
pm-pmu – suspend the computer on machines using a Macintosh-style PMU
Synopsis
- pm-pmu
Description
pm-pmu is a command line program to suspend a computer on machines using a Macintosh-style PMU
Exit Codes
The command succeeds (status 0) if the machine uses a Macintosh-style PMU, and suspended successfully. The command fails (status other than 0) otherwise. It is designed to be easy to use in shell scripts.
0 (true)
- System was suspended using PMU.
1 (false)
- System could not be suspended using PMU.
Options
This program follows the usual GNU command line syntax, with long options starting with two dashes (`-‘). A summary of options is included below.
–suspend
- Suspend the computer.
–help
- Show help message.
